The MAX536BEWE is a high-performance, quad, 12-bit digital-to-analog converter (DAC) designed by Maxim Integrated. This precision voltage-output DAC offers an ideal solution for applications requiring multiple DACs with high accuracy and low power consumption. The MAX536BEWE operates with a single +5V power supply, making it suitable for many digital systems.
Each of the four DACs within the MAX536BEWE can be independently programmed via a 3-wire serial interface, which is compatible with SPI, QSPI, and MICROWIRE protocols, as well as most DSPs. This interface flexibility enables easy integration into a variety of digital systems. The device's 12-bit resolution ensures fine granularity in analog output, allowing for precise control in applications such as automated test equipment, data acquisition systems, and closed-loop control systems.
The MAX536BEWE is also known for its excellent stability and low noise performance. It features a power-on reset circuit that clears the DAC outputs to midscale (0V) when power is applied, ensuring a predictable startup state. Furthermore, the device includes a clear input to reset all DACs to midscale, and a load DAC input to simultaneously update all DACs. This makes it easy to synchronize outputs in critical timing applications.
Maxim Integrated has packaged the MAX536BEWE in a 16-pin Wide SO package, which is designed to meet the requirements of space-constrained applications. The compact form factor, combined with the low power dissipation, makes the MAX536BEWE an excellent choice for portable and battery-operated devices.
